CSU Launch Ram Transfer Academy

 

FRCC, CSU Launch Ram Transfer Academy 

I want to congratulate everyone who has been working on building our new Ram Transfer Academy with Colorado State University. This has been a truly cross-functional team effort, involving staff and leaders from Academic Affairs, Enrollment Management & Student Success and our Strategic Marketing & Communications division. The program will help FRCC students prepare for a smooth transfer to CSU, helping break barriers to higher education. 

In January, FRCC and CSU held a formal signing ceremony for the academy at the Grays Peak building at the Larimer Campus. Learn more about the Ram Transfer Academy. 

 

This new partnership is funded by the Aspen Institute. The program builds on several successful transfer partnerships including the Wolves to Rams Learning Community, the NSF W2R S-STEM Scholars Program, CIC Computer Science Transfer Program and the NIH NoCo Bridges to the Baccalaureate Research Traineeship.  

 

We are also happy to announce that Erin Pitts has been hired as the assistant director of the new Ram Transfer Academy and Orlando Cruz has been hired as the academy’s success coach. Both Erin and Orlando will be splitting their time between all FRCC campuses and CSU. Together, they bring 15 years of experience specifically supporting FRCC students in their transfer to and through CSU!

Bookstore Solutions Initiative  

  • The Colorado Community College System is currently in negotiations with Barnes & Noble College (BNC) to be the systemwide bookstore provider 
  • Barnes & Noble College has acknowledged the customer service needs of the system, and their team is engaged in earnest discussions with the system to ensure those are addressed.
  • Feedback on First Day Complete was received and will not be pursued by Barnes & Noble College during these contract negotiations. The CCCS committee remains committed to the position that this is not a viable option for any of the colleges in the system. 
  • The FRCC transition team will meet with the BNC in February to go over FRCC specific requirements.

Enrollment Update 

As you may know, the final day to add or drop classes for the spring semester is this coming Wednesday. Our spring semester census should be finalized next week, and we will be ready to share those numbers in the upcoming weeks. Preliminary numbers indicate an increase in enrollment for both degree/certificate-seeking students, as well as our concurrent enrollment population.  

The Division of Strategy & Innovation, in partnership with Enrollment Management & Student Success, will provide additional details about enrollment by campus, degree types and student characteristics. Stay tuned for that update.
